Handover — Inkpress invoice renderer

New folks: Inkpress turns billing records into PDF invoices for Trellmark customers. Key facts. Rendering is synchronous under 5 pages, queued above that. Fonts are bundled; don't rely on system fonts, the Caldoria locale broke twice that way. The margin bug from last quarter is fixed but the regression test is flaky — rerun before blaming your change. Template changes need a visual diff attached to the PR. To run the renderer locally, apply the following configuration values first.

service settings:
[casax]
port = 6379
team = rusir
host = casax.zemvarhq.corp
region = outer-4
access_code = ac_9808ce
timeout_ms = 1500

Escalation: if the Pellgrove loyalty-points ledger shows reconciliation drift above 0.1% for two consecutive runs, halt the nightly accrual job and page the ledger on-call. Do not replay transactions manually; use the replay tool with dry-run first. Release manager must hold any ledger-touching deploys until drift clears. For escalation beyond on-call, contact the ledger platform leads.

alerts address for kajog-tadup: druox@plorvanet.internal

INTERNAL MEMO — Lease Renegotiation, Tarnwick Depot

For the incoming director: negotiations with Halbrook Estates on the Tarnwick depot lease resume next month. We secured a provisional 12% reduction against a seven-year term, conditional on us absorbing minor maintenance. Counsel has reviewed the break clause and flags no concerns. Facilities will circulate updated floor allocations once terms are signed. For context, the confidential note on related business plans is set out below.

board note of yadup-fajef: Druiusox Holdings is in early talks to buy Norwynek Systems for about $186.0 million. The Kaseth launch date is June 24, and nothing goes to the press before then. Legal wants the Quenethek Group term sheet withdrawn before November 27.

// Max prefetch window for GalleryWhisper audio-guide tracks.
// Plugin authors: do not exceed this. Museum Wi-Fi at partner
// sites (e.g. the Oakmere Hall pilot) throttles bulk fetches,
// and larger windows caused stutter on exhibit transitions.
// Value is tuned per the Larchfield bench tests; if your plugin
// needs more headroom, request a quota bump instead of patching
// this. Compatibility is guaranteed only for the build below.

pipeline stamp: htk9_ce63042d9